    Abstract: A communication system may include an access point (AP), user equipment (UE) device, and reconfigurable intelligent surface (RIS). The UE may control the RIS by transmitting control signals that configure antenna elements on the RIS. The RIS may reflect wireless signals between the UE and the AP. The RIS may be known to the network. The UE may transmit a report to the AP that includes information about the RIS. The UE may receive assistance information from the AP. The UE may control the RIS based at least in part on the assistance information. The UE may transmit measurement reports to the AP. The AP may update its signal beams based on the information about the RIS and the measurement reports. Providing the network with awareness of the RIS may serve to optimize the wireless performance of the UE device and/or the network.

    Abstract: This disclosure relates to techniques for periodic reference signal activation and deactivation in a wireless communication system. Information configuring periodic reference signals may be received by a wireless device. Information deactivating some or all of the periodic reference signals may be received by the wireless device. The information deactivating some or all of the periodic reference signals may be received using different signaling type than the information configuring the periodic reference signals.

    Abstract: Implementations of the subject technology provide occupant-based audio for enclosed environments. For example, an apparatus having an enclosure and one or more speakers may determine a location and/or an identity of an occupant within an enclosed environment defined by the enclosure, and operate the one or more speakers to provide audio output to the location of the occupant. The apparatus may also operate the one or more speakers to reduce the audio output to one or more other locations within the enclosure, such as to one or more non-occupant locations and/or to one or more locations of one or more other occupants. The audio output may be occupant-specific audio output, such as a personalized notifications, in one or more implementations.

    Abstract: An Integrated Circuit (IC) includes a storage element and control circuitry. The control circuitry is configured to select, responsively to a scan-enable control, between a functional-data input and a scan-data input to serve as an input to the storage element, to selectively disable toggling of an output of the storage element, responsively to a clock-enable control, by gating a clock signal provided to the storage element, and, while the clock-enable control indicates that the output of the storage element is to be disabled from toggling, to select the input of the storage element to be the scan-data input.

    Abstract: Techniques are disclosed relating to computing security and privacy. In some embodiments, a computing device provides, to a service computing system, a service request that identifies an action and includes an anonymous identifier for a user of the computing device. The computing device receives, from the service computing system, a score request for a trustworthiness score indicative of the user's trustworthiness. In response to receiving the score request from the service computing system, the computing device provides information indicative of the user's identity to a scoring computing system and receives the trustworthiness score and a corresponding score signature from the scoring computing system. In response to receiving the score and the score signature from the scoring computing system, the computing device provides the score to the service computing system.

    Abstract: Apparatuses, systems, and methods for overhead reduction for multi-carrier beam selection and power control. A user equipment device (UE) may receive an uplink beam configuration for a group of component carriers and may communicate using the uplink beam configuration for the group of component carriers. The UE may receive an updated uplink beam configuration for the group of component carriers. The update uplink beam configuration may include a medium access control (MAC) control element (CE) that may update a pathloss reference signal for the group of component carriers. The MAC CE may include an indication of a spatial relation for aperiodic or semi-persistent sounding reference signals for the group of component carriers, an indication of a transmission control indicator for a physical downlink control channel, an indication of an update for a physical uplink shared channel, and/or an indication of an update for a sounding reference signal.

    Abstract: Some aspects of this disclosure relate to apparatuses and methods for implementing techniques for generating a report result based on a set of measurements performed at measurement gaps during a reporting period. The set of measurements are performed on a reference signal at a first bandwidth part (BWP) or a second BWP when BWP switching is performed. The first BWP has a first measurement gap configuration, the second BWP has a second measurement gap configuration. The measurement gaps of the reporting period are configured according to a third measurement gap configuration that is determined based on the first measurement gap configuration and the second measurement gap configuration.

    Abstract: Various implementations disclosed herein include devices, systems, and methods that identify a gesture based on event camera data and frame-based camera data (e.g., for a CGR environment). In some implementations at an electronic device having a processor, event camera data is obtained corresponding to light (e.g., IR light) reflected from a physical environment and received at an event camera. In some implementations, frame-based camera data is obtained corresponding to light (e.g., visible light) reflected from the physical environment and received at a frame-based camera. In some implementations, a subset of the event camera data is identified based on the frame-based camera data, and a gesture (e.g., of a person in the physical environment) is identified based on the subset of event camera data. In some implementations, a path (e.g., of a hand) by tracking a grouping of blocks of event camera events in the subset of event camera data.

    Abstract: An electronic device can include a touch sensitive display and an electrode electrically isolated from the touch sensitive display. The electrode can be configured to receive a first signal associated with performing a first function of the electronic device. In some examples, the electronic device can include a controller in electrical communication with the touch sensitive display and the electrode. The controller can be configured to perform a second function via the electrode, the second function including driving a second signal to the electrode when the electrode and the touch sensitive display are touched simultaneously. The second signal can have a characteristic distinguishable from naturally occurring capacitive noise detected by the touch sensitive display.

    Abstract: Apparatus and methods are provided for CSI enhancement for multi-TRP coherent joint transmission. A user equipment (UE) receives signals from a plurality of transmission and reception points (TRPs). The UE determines, based on the signals, multiple TRP (multi-TRP) coherent joint transmission (CJT) channel state information (CSI) report information for a codebook based on a spatial basis selection matrix, a combination coefficient matrix, and a frequency basis selection matrix. The spatial basis selection matrix is layer common, polarization common, and TRP independent. The UE reports, to one or more of the plurality of TRPs, the multi-TRP CJT CSI report information.

    Abstract: Methods and systems are disclosed for a UE of a wireless communication network to recover from MCG radio link failures in a MR-DC system when the SCG is deactivated or otherwise not enabled. When a MCG link failure is detected and the SCG is deactivated, the UE may activate the SCG for the UE to use the SCG link to transmit and receive signaling messages or data as part of the MCG failure recovery procedure. When the MCG link failure is detected and the UE is configured to add the SCG upon the satisfaction of certain condition, but the condition has not occurred, the UE may check to determine whether one condition is MCG failure and whether the radio link quality of the SCG exceeds a threshold. If the radio link quality of the SCG exceeds the threshold, the UE may apply the SCG configuration to add the SCG.

    Abstract: A next generation NodeB (gNB) implements a radio access network (RAN) convergence functionality for new radio (NR) and wireless local area network (WLAN) access, the gNB further implementing a split architecture comprising a central unit (CU) and a distributed unit (DU) for each of the NR access and WLAN access. The gNB receives a data packet for transmission to a user equipment (UE) implementing the RAN convergence functionality, the data packet comprising one of a control plane (CP) packet or a user plane (UP) packet. The gNB splits the data packet via a convergence layer residing on the NR CU or a convergence layer residing on the WLAN CU and transmits the split data packet over the NR access and the WLAN access.

    Abstract: Systems and methods of early termination of uplink data transmissions for a UE are described. The UE transmits capacity information that indicates that the UE supports use of an ETS. The ETS indicates successful reception by the eNB of the uplink data prior to an end of a scheduled transmission period to transmit repeated instances of the data. The UE receives a schedule for repeated transmissions of the data that is based on a coverage level of the UE, and then transmits sets of one or more repetitions. After the transmission, the UE monitors a predetermined resource whether the ETS is present or whether the ETS indicates an ACK. If the ETS indicates successful reception, the UE terminates transmission of the remaining repetitions of the data and enters a sleep mode or transmits other uplink data.

    Abstract: Systems and methods of placeshifting media playback between two or more devices are provided. For example, a method for placeshifting media may include downloading onto a first device an index of files accessed or modified on a second device via a data storage server, at least one of the files being a media file played on the second device. The first device may display a user selectable list of the files on the first device before issuing a request for the media file to the data storage server. The data storage server may send the media file to the first device from the data storage server, and the first device may play back the media file where the second device left off.

    Abstract: Some embodiments provide a method for a first device that identifies definitions of different groups of devices, each of which is defined by a set of properties required for a device to be a member. The method monitors properties of the first device to determine when the device is eligible for membership in a group. When the first device is eligible for membership in a first group of which the device is not a member, the method sends an application for membership in the first group signed with at least a private key of the device to at least one other device that is a member of the first group. When the first device becomes ineligible for membership in a second group of which the first device is a member, the method removes the device from the second group and notifies other devices that are members of the second group.
